Well, this is fun isn’t it?

Fresh outta Brisbane, this seven-piece is ready to show you what ska-loving gypsy punks are all about. Mondegreen is fast-paced, horn-driven and has ‘soak me in vodka and make a real man out of me’ written all over it.

Gogol Bordello are clearly a huge influence (and a sonic point of reference), but there are moments like 5 Days (Interlude) and Ship Of Fools that’d also be right at home on a Less Than Jake record. If you like music with a bit of fun in it, Mondegreen is for you.
